Many educators currently lack formal, structured training in simulation pedagogy, which limits their ability to design and facilitate effective simulation experiences. This lack of preparation leads to inconsistencies in delivering evidence-based simulation-based education (SBE) across healthcare settings. As a result, the full educational benefits of simulation are not realized, and gaps in faculty competency may ultimately compromise the quality and safety of patient care. This program aims to enhance educators’ knowledge and skills in simulation pedagogy aligned with best practice standards, thereby increasing their competence and confidence in designing and facilitating effective healthcare simulations.

Upon successful completion of this course, the participant will be able to:

  • Define healthcare simulation and explain its role in supporting clinical judgment and patient safety.
  • Explain educational theories that support the use of simulation.
  • Identify key simulation organizations (INACSL, SSH, ASPE) and explain their roles in establishing best practice standards.
  • Identify best practices in simulation facilitation for clinical practice.
  • Describe how the prebrief prepares the learner to be successful in meeting the simulation objectives.
  • Compare and contrast commonly used debriefing models and methods.
  • Demonstrate understanding of ethical principles in simulation.

Karen Kelly, RN, BSN

Karen Kelly earned her Bachelor of Science in Nursing and Master of Science in Nursing from the University of Central Florida. While completing her MSN in 2012, she served as a hospital clinical educator, teaching for the Critical Care Nurse Internship Program for new graduates. In 2015, she became the first Simulation Strategist for AdventHealth’s CFD Simulation Program, designing simulations for nurses and clinical professionals and supporting AdventHealth University initiatives.

Certified as a Healthcare Simulation Educator since 2016, Karen has trained clinical educators in the INACSL Healthcare Simulation Standards of Best Practice and presented nationally on modernizing graduate nurse orientation. She developed the FACET (Formative Assessment of Clinical Education and Training) tool for evaluating new nurse simulations. She is the Director of Experiential Learning at AdventHealth University with a focus on creating undergraduate nursing simulations and mentoring faculty in simulation-based education. She is an active member of INACSL.
